Ujjain Cultural Immersion Itinerary - July 30-31, 2023
Sunday July 30: Exploring Ujjain's Heritage
Immerse yourself in the rich cultural heritage of Ujjain as you spend a day exploring the city's iconic landmarks and sacred sites.
Morning: Begin your day with a visit to the Mahakaleshwar Jyotirlinga Temple, one of the twelve Jyotirlingas in India. Witness the morning rituals and seek blessings at this ancient Shiva temple. Estimated Time: 2 hours Cost: Free
Afternoon: Continue your cultural immersion by visiting the Kal Bhairav Temple, dedicated to Lord Bhairav. Experience the spiritual atmosphere and marvel at the intricate architectural details of this sacred site. Estimated Time: 1 hour Cost: Free
Evening: Conclude your day with a serene boat ride on the Shipra River, offering panoramic views of Ujjain's ghats (riverfront steps) and temples. Experience the tranquility of the river and witness the evening aarti (prayer) ceremony. Estimated Time: 1 hour Cost: INR 100 per person
Monday July 31: Historical and Cultural Delights
Continue your cultural immersion in Ujjain by discovering historical sites and exploring the city's vibrant arts and crafts scene.
Morning: Start your day with a visit to the Vedh Shala (Observatory), an ancient astronomical observatory built by Maharaja Jai Singh II. Marvel at the precision and accuracy of the instruments used to study celestial bodies. Estimated Time: 1 hour Cost: Free
Afternoon: Dive into Ujjain's rich art and craft heritage at the Kala Vithika Crafts Museum. Admire exquisite handcrafted artifacts showcasing the skills and traditions of local artisans. Estimated Time: 2 hours Cost: INR 50 per person
Evening: Conclude your cultural journey with a visit to the Bhartrihari Caves, a complex of ancient caves associated with the sage Bhartrihari. Explore the caves and enjoy the scenic views of Ujjain from this vantage point. Estimated Time: 1.5 hours Cost: Free
